EA Hinting At More Titles For The Nintendo Switch

Since the announcement of FIFA 18 coming to the Nintendo Switch many are wondering about any other titles that EA may have up their sleeves for the new console. Worldwide Studios Vice President Patrick Soderlund stated in an interview that he was in fact pretty excited for the Switch but couldn’t yet say whether or not the company will release some of its titles on the console or create all new ones. According to Nintendo Insider Soderlund said that “I’m a gigantic Nintendo fanboy,” and even added that he brings his Switch everywhere with him.

EA is one of many publishers that will bring their games to any platform available if there is a good enough opportunity for them to thrive, and it seems like the Switch is not excluded from this. “We will appear on any platform where there are consumers, and players,” he said. “We believe that we want to be a part of the Switch, and help Nintendo grow that installed base; that’s why you’ll see FIFA, which by the way is really good this year. It’s a full-fledged FIFA game, for the first time to be honest, on a portable device.”

Soderlund also adds that the amount of resources that EA will put into any developments have to be considered as this is a part of any business. Teasing that EA might be bringing more games to the Switch after FIFA 18 and depending on the success of these titles, more could continue.

“So for us it’s about supporting the platform, building technology for the platform, testing it out with big things like FIFA–and maybe a couple of others, we’ll see–and if they go well, I see no reason why we shouldn’t have as much of our portfolio on that platform as possible. I hope we get there, that would be my personal ambition.”
